Output 431af5e37a3502073f781360c43c885548a7a757ecb019936e39f1890bf8e389:0

value
1843689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5315c53d4055a1883adb81a4180be37f91611d5f OP_EQUAL
address
39GL66zfdXbApRD5BWvFhEThEpfVExEBty
transaction
431af5e37a3502073f781360c43c885548a7a757ecb019936e39f1890bf8e389